Flashbacks (featuring special guest stars Steven Culp, Jesse Metcalfe and Roger Bart) take us back to key moments in time for Bree, Lynette, Susan and Gabrielle and how they connect to the present. After hearing Betty's message on her cellphone about Matthew being a murderer Bree realizes she needs to escape from the psychiatric hospital and help Danielle, who has run away with him. When he sees Mike buying an engagement ring, Karl buys Susan a house. Lynette finds out that Tom has an illegitimate daughter from before they were married. Gabrielle discovers a shocking secret her husband has been keeping from her. Add a recap »

- Error: After Karl and Mike get into a fist fight over Susan, Susan goes over to see how Mike is doing. When he tells her he chipped his tooth, she goes into her purse to get Orson (her dentist-friend)'s business card to give to him, in the next scene her bag is on her shoulder again. edit »
- Although they are credited for this episode, Mark Moses (Paul Young), Cody Kasch (Zach Young), Brent Kinsman (Preston Scavo), Shane Kinsman (Porter Scavo), Zane Huett (Parker Scavo) do not appear in this episode, the second half of what was originally aired as a two-hour episode. edit »
- Even though they are credited, Nicollette Sheridan (Edie Britt) and Shawn Pyform (Andrew Van de Kamp) do not appear in this episode. edit »
